Concept notes: Managerial functions typically include planning, organizing, leading, and controlling. Employee relations is not traditionally considered a core managerial function.
Common Mistakes: Students may confuse employee relations with leading, as both involve interactions with employees.
Explanations: Managerial functions are traditionally categorized into planning, organizing, leading, and controlling. Employee relations, while important, is not a core function but rather a component of the leading function. Therefore, it is not included in the list of managerial functions.
